Deep Analysis
PLUG (PLUG) has a Gross Margin of -13.2% as of May 2026.
This places PLUG in the 9th percentile of the Industrials sector, which has a median Gross Margin of 28.9% and a sector average of 846.3%. PLUG's Gross Margin is 145.8% below the sector median, a significant divergence that warrants closer examination. In context: Gross margin reveals pricing power and cost structure. Software companies often sustain 70–80%; manufacturers typically 30–50%. Expansion is a bullish signal.
